    I have used Rogaine for 35 years but have only been doing PRP + microneedling for 6 weeks (once every 2 weeks). I am sure that the hairs have thickened in areas that where they were miniaturizing. Its too early for me to say if anything has grown back but my understanding is that the combination of PRP + microneedling can regrow hairs that have fallen out up to 2 years earlier.     Its been 3 months since I started PRP at home (DIY). Every 2 weeks I draw 4 test tubes of blood for injecting into the front and the next day draw 4 more test tubes for injecting into the crown for a total of 16 different blood draw, spins and injections and 64 test tubes.

    Results: The hair that was miniaturizing got thicker (I don't see my scalp anymore) and the hair in the front middle that was in the process of falling out has stopped. But unfortunately there hasn't been any new hair regrowth that I can tell. I took picture last week and in 3 more months I will post my results. Even though the benefits have been modest, I think its been worth it.
